    The purpose of this survey paper is to clarify some of the underlying principles and new ideas in the theory of the selective differentiation. In the fifth part of the paper, the author thoroughly discusses the problems of the relationships between selective, biselective, path system and composite differentiation. The first part of the paper deals with the history of the selective differentiation. There are mentioned some results and ideas of several papers which are basic for the introduction of the selective differentiation. In the second part, the author defines what is a selection and gives some examples of selections. The third part includes some interesting results about bilateral selective derivatives and the ideas of l-r-derivatives and biselective derivatives. The idea of the biselective differentiation has its origin in the Gleyzal's convergence idea of interval functions. The fourth part is devoted to the problems which are in connection with the fact that the selective derivative of any function (if it exists) is a function of the honorary Baire class two. The author deals with these problems in three research projects. In the first project he formulates the question: Whether it is possible for any selective differentiable function f with respect to a selection s, having the selective derivative sf' of the second class of Baire, to give an alternate selection t, such that the selective derivative tf' is of the first class of Baire. The answer to this question is in a common paper of the author and C. E. Weil. The second project deals with the question, whether it is possible to give some conditions on a selection s which guarantee that the selective derivative sf' of any function f (if it exists) is of the first class of Baire. This question was the motive for the introduction of the notion of balanced selections. The third project is in connection with Snyder's results on boundary functions and Stolz angle limit. The author investigates here the selective differentiation under so-called \(\alpha\) hv\(\beta\)-limit in the open half-plane. In the last part the author discusses some results of Lazarow and two papers which in between were published.
